DETROIT — Along with dozens of other college head coaches, Michigan Wolverines football first-year head man Sherrone Moore addressed high school football players at the Wayne State National Showcase satellite camp Thursday in Detroit.

Moore’s message focused on having a high-level work ethic, being “smart, tough and dependable,” and proving doubters wrong.

“I appreciate you guys coming out here, waking up and getting this work in. Make sure you guys thank your family members that brought you guys out here, parents, people that support you, coaches, whoever that is.

“I’m Sherrone Moore. I’m the head coach at the University of Michigan, a proud member of our 2023 national championship team. How it was built — a foundation of hard work. We had talented players, but if you [have to] your tail off every single second, every single moment to become a champion. Every single coach you talk to throughout this process — whether it’s here, whether it’s at another university — make sure you put that first: the hard work.

“Everybody has these star ratings and rankings. That’s all well and good. But that shit doesn’t really matter when you get to a university, because everybody’s even. So make sure you think about that. Always stay humble, never be complacent and always put the work first.

“What we look for are smart, tough, dependable human beings. That’s it! Smart, tough and dependable.

Continued the Michigan coach: “Process, pursuit, standard is what we’re working with right now. We always talked about last year, ‘Process over prize.’ We saw in our indoor [facility], it said 1997 national championship. That was the last time we had one. We got sick and tired of people coming into the building talking about, ‘national championship team, national championship team.’ Well, guess what? We went in and attacked that every single day. That’s what we did, and competed with the best of the best in what we think is the best conference in the country, to go do that.

“But to do that, you have to have a mindset and you have to go to a different place than going to hang out, going to play video games, go out and party. You gotta separate yourself than that.

“Everybody is going to have haters. Your haters are holding your breath for you to fail. Your job is to make their asses suffocate. That’s what your job is to do. So when you guys go out there today, make sure you’re putting the work in, listening, looking, following directions and doing it at the highest level to go help yourself compete and go put the best film on tape when you guys get to high school this year and you go attack the moment.”
